Course overview
Develop your professional and specialist skills in hairdressing or barbering to become a Lead or Senior Stylist, through the study of creativity and development of advanced hairdressing or barbering skills. As a Lead or Senior Stylist, you will be repsonsible for customer satisfaction and maintaining a clientele for the business.
What Does The Programme Include
You will be employed as an apprentice for at least 30 hours a week. You will have a workplace mentor or supervisor who will be responcible for your training and welfare at work. You will attend college for workshop sessions as required. An assessor will visit you in the workplace to assess your progress against standards and set SMART objectives.
Entry Requirements
Individual employers set their own entry requirements, however, you will typically require 5 GCSEs at grades 4/C or above including English and maths.
Potential Future Career
As a fully competent Lead or Senior Stylist in a Hairdresser’s or Baber Shop, you can further your progression by undertaking additional qualifications or open your own salon.
Course Content
Skills & Knowledge:
- Researches fashion forward trends.
- Create a collection of hairstyle looks.
- Present a collection of hair looks.
- Sectioning and cutting guidelines.
- Precision and personalised cutting techniques.
- Creative colour conversion.
- Advanced colour conversion (correction).
- Client Consultation
Behaviours:
- Facilities safe working practices: ensures safety of self and others, challenges safety issues.
- Problem solving: works to identify and ensure root causes are resolved, demostrating a tenacious approach.
- Flexible and adaptable: flexbility to changing working environment and demands.
- Demonstrates and encourages curiosity to foster new ways of thinking and working.
- Creativity: demostrates individual flair and imagination using fashion forward trends in hair and approaches to their work.
- Professional Development: promote own professional development, embraces continual development and improvement.
